The diagram shows rectangular box ABCDEFGH, with A = (2, 3, 1), G = (10, 7, 5), and edges parallel to the coordinate axes. (a) Write parametric equations for line FD. (b) Let M be the midpoint of segment CD and draw segment EM. Find coordinates for the point P that is two thirds of the way from E to M. (c) Show that P is also on segment FD. Why was it predictable that segments FD and EM would intersect?
